Authorization classification of agency authority
1, general agent, that is, to participate in litigation mediation and provide legal assistance on behalf of others.
2. Special authorization means representing prosecution, stating facts, participating in debates and mediation, representing litigation requests, acknowledging, waiving or changing, counterclaiming or appealing, and signing legal documents.
Principal-agent matters are the specific contents of principal-agent
The agency authority of the principal agent is not a right item.
The agency authority of an entrusted agent is different from that of a legal agent. The agency authority of the entrusted agent is bound by the authorization of the parties, and the entrusted agent can only represent the litigation within the scope authorized by the parties. Within the scope of agency authority, litigation agency activities, such as acting as an agent and accepting litigation, which are independently carried out by entrusted agents, are regarded as litigation acts of the parties and have legal effect on the parties.

How to write the traffic accident power of attorney
Update time: accessed 2021-1911:32: 041497.
How to write the traffic accident power of attorney
The lawyer replied.
To write a power of attorney for traffic accidents, first write the title "Power of Attorney for Traffic Accidents". Then make clear the basic situation, agency matters and agency authority of the principal and the principal. Finally, both parties sign and seal and confirm the date of entrustment.
Legal basis:
Article 58 of the Civil Procedure Law of People's Republic of China (PRC)
The parties and legal representatives may entrust one or two persons as agents ad litem.
The following persons may be entrusted as agents ad litem:
(1) Lawyers and grassroots legal service workers;
(2) Close relatives or staff members of the parties concerned;
(three) citizens recommended by the community, units and relevant social groups where the parties are located.
Article 59 of the Civil Procedure Law of People's Republic of China (PRC)
If another person is entrusted to represent the lawsuit, a power of attorney signed or sealed by the client must be submitted to the people's court.
The power of attorney must specify the entrusted matters and authority. An agent ad litem must have the special authorization of the client, and can admit, waive or change the claim, make a settlement, file a counterclaim or appeal on his behalf.
